Story

Started in the year 2008 with just 25 children, this Project aims at solving the problems hidden by the fact that orphans and vulnerable children are invisible; yet by the very nature of their situation, they are included among those that are classified as disadvantaged and poor. Children are subsumed within the poverty categories most often referred to such as households, communities, people – which means that there is a high tendency to focus on adult-related poverty while child problems are ignored, partly because children have little power and influence within a group that contains adults. Findings reflect that children in abject problems can be recognized by rather elementary (as opposed to sophisticated) criteria. Top on the list is absence of basic necessities such as shelter, food, clothing and water. Equally important is the ‘human condition’ in terms of physical health and parental care and protection. Schooling is high on the list as a critical criterion in determining who is extremely or modestly a vulnerable and disadvantaged child. While there seems to be national consensus among donors, the public sector and civil society that the government has made commendable progress in implementing PEAP (Poverty Eradication Action Plan) as flexibly as possible, it’s evolving nature, due to the participatory and consultative reviews it undergoes regularly, does not address many of the development challenges Disadvantaged children face today. It would take lobbying and advocacy interventions to ensure that the needs and demands of children in abject poverty are met.

Specific Objectives:

  • To improve the quality of life of the orphans and vulnerable children by establishing a permanent home, school and health care centre for them.
  • To train care givers in care giving skills to enable these children get adequate care, love and support
  • To provide adequate education to these children to make them good citizens and have a better future through good education right from a tender age.
  • To create awareness to the community and the outside world the need to protect and support the vulnerable children and the orphans as well as protecting their rights

  • Children from Hongirana have won prizes in Drawing, Kabaddi and Kho-Kho at Range (Taluk) level competitions
  • 3 children are studying in High school now
  • Many children have passed first class and some of them have scored above 80%
